在我们的CI/CD环境中,我们通过sdkman将docker镜像与预先安装的java结合在一起。但是有一个小问题,版本号经常改变,我们的docker构建失败,因为缺少包版本。例如: sdk install java 8.0.232-zulu
Stop! java 8.0.232-zulu is not available.* java has not been released yet
在更新和升级sdkman、删除.sdkman并重新安装它、卸载java包并重新安装它们之后,这个问题仍然存在。me@myMachine myProject $ sdk default java 8.0.252.hs-adptDefault java version set to 11.0.7.hs-a
运行OSX 10.15.7,sdkman 5.9.1+575。 sdkman似乎已经进入了一个糟糕的状态,它认为Java 1.8既安装了又没有安装。/Library/Java/JavaVirtualMachines/adoptopenjdk-8.jdk: No such file or directory Java1.8是通过sdkman安装的,工作正常,然后我运行了一个全面的brew upgrade,我认为它试
error: error while loading String, class file '/modules/java.base/java/lang/String.class' is broken我在一台运行macOS的机器上,sbt是通过自制安装的我已经尝试升级到sbt的最新版本(1.3.10),但
我按照这里的指南在Ubuntu16.04中安装了kotlin和JDK,但是当我运行这个的时候,我得到了这个错误
error: no class roots are found in the JDK path: /usr/lib/jvm/java-9-openjdk-amd64这是我的第一次,所以基本上我不知道该做什么。
我在用SDKMAN!我正在尝试为我的项目编写sdkinit.sh脚本,以便用特定的工具版本初始化当前的shell。source "$HOME/.sdkman/bin/sdkman-init.sh"sdk use java 8.0.212-zulu
尽管我调用了脚本,但根据下面的输出-e Using java version